Short Summary
Green Gold Animation Private Limited filed an appeal challenging the abandonment of opposition proceedings related to the 'MIGHTY RAJU' device mark. The High Court was asked to restore the opposition and allow the applicant to file a counter statement. However, the appellant subsequently conveyed instructions that they did not wish to pursue the appeal. Consequently, the Madras High Court dismissed the appeal as withdrawn.

B.Barun Melsungen AgvsMr.Mohinder Paul
Plaintiffs filed a suit seeking permanent injunction against defendants, alleging that the defendant's product, MEDIFLON SAFETY, infringed on their Patent No. 210062 for an IV catheter assembly with a safety guard. The court examined the claims of both parties and found that the plaintiff's invention lacked inventive step and there was no prima facie case of infringement.
Neoculi Pty LtdvsThe Controller Of Patents And Designs and Anr.
Neoculi Pty Ltd appealed a rejection order by the Assistant Controller of Patent and Designs, Kolkata, which rejected its application for an antibacterial pharmaceutical composition. The rejection was based on lack of inventive steps, unpatentability under Section 3(e), and insufficient disclosure. The High Court found the impugned order unsustainable due to non-application of mind and remanded the matter.
Dura-Line India Pvt LtdvsJain Irrigation Systems Ltd.
Dura-Line India Pvt Ltd filed a suit against Jain Irrigation Systems Ltd., alleging infringement of its patent and design related to non-metallic pipes embedded with tracer cables for leak detection. The defendant challenged both the infringement and the validity of the patent itself. After extensive proceedings, the Delhi High Court ruled in favor of Dura-Line, upholding the validity of the Suit Patent and decreeing the suit.
Docbel Industries & Anr.vsBraun Aktiengesellschaft
The Delhi High Court disposed of the dispute between Docbel Industries and Braun Aktiengesellschaft based on a comprehensive settlement agreement. The court accepted the compromise, which involved the formal assignment of Trademark registration no. 405367 (the mark BRAUN) from Appellant No. 2 to the Respondent. Furthermore, the parties agreed to the handover of all related documents and financial considerations, effectively resolving the underlying litigation.
Ms Khatema Fibres LimitedvsDr Rakesh Chandra Rastogi & Ors.
The Delhi High Court issued an order allowing Ms Khatema Fibres Limited to proceed with a rectification petition against the registered trademark 'KHATEMA' held by Defendant No. 1. The court formally initiated the proceedings, granting both parties specific timeframes—four weeks for the defendant's reply and six weeks for filing composite written synopses in related applications. This order sets the stage for a detailed legal battle over the validity of the trademark registration.
